WRC PC Steam version first impressions: So far, :+1:. It’s early access so there are bugs and imperfections to expect. I’ve had a few CTDs as well.

Lots of content, single and multiplayer. It’s nice to be able to drive all cars and tracks off the bat instead of grind. PC users can use their mouse in the menu!

Group B cars ARE NO JOKE. Talk about raw power. :eyes:

Fps 100+ at max/ultra settings
Hardware- Nvidia 4090 OC, i9 13900KS, 64GB memory
Resolution 5120x1440

HOWEVER… there are occasional stutters and momentary freezes. (I’ve seen reports on other outlets about this.) It seems to happen when you make contact with objects off the track. I wonder if this happens on the console (XBOX, Playstation).

The replay and photomode functions are handy for post race analysis and snazzy screenshots.

Force feedback on my wheel (Moza) did not work initially. Got some quick help on the Moza discord and updated a WRC user file to enable it. FFB on paved road stages is basically non-existent. But on dirt and gravel it works good.
